Transaction 5e76831e18841b48edb1249ab07bef2bcefdb64aec6a39334b4efd9d7efc9216

1 Input
2 Outputs
  • 5e76831e18841b48edb1249ab07bef2bcefdb64aec6a39334b4efd9d7efc9216:0
  • value  2295241
    address  1Efs5DT4txWP247PRA33PnyeRapPxjEuc1
  • 5e76831e18841b48edb1249ab07bef2bcefdb64aec6a39334b4efd9d7efc9216:1
  • value  11428532
    address  1CMEBzpnHgHxDMcQhSYLab5NVn2hyMf64b